Neither is better, its all in the setup.
ZEX is safer off the shelf, but NOS can be made just as safe.
the reason ZEX is sooo safe is the WIndow/WOT switches,
Ur nitrous will ONLY inject between a desired RPM range, and ONLY when its at WOT( wide open throttle). The only thing the user needs to not do, is learn not to spray in 5th ( u spary to long = hard on motor)

THe button is just to start the spray, which u can do with any kit. U can do it with a zex kit, instead of having a WOT trigger.
1st you arm the nitrous, then you can either
A) push a button
or
B) use a WOT switch
both work fine, the WOT isjust safer, because some moron MIGHT be tempted to engage nitrous at half throttle at 2000 RPM's which is a baad thing.
